Most athletes eat the wrong thing. Nutrition in sports isn’t just about calories, it’s about fueling performance. The food you choose can make or break your game. Picture this: a runner carb-loading on pasta. Sounds right, but what if I told you that too many simple carbs can crash their energy? Here’s the kicker: protein timing can be more crucial than you think. Consuming protein right after a workout boosts muscle recovery by up to 50%. That’s insane! Now, let’s talk hydration. Most people think water is enough, but athletes need electrolytes too. Dehydration can drop performance by 10%, and that’s the difference between winning and losing. Digging deeper, you’ll find that the timing of meals matters. Eating at the right times can maximize energy levels and enhance focus. A pre-workout snack can elevate performance, while a post-workout meal can accelerate recovery. Check this out: Omega-3 fatty acids can reduce muscle soreness. Yes, fish like salmon can help you bounce back faster. Now, here comes the big revelation. Some athletes are turning to plant-based diets. Studies show they can enhance endurance and recovery while reducing inflammation. Doesn’t get better than that. And the surprising part? Supplements aren’t always the answer. Whole foods often outperform pills. Your body craves real nutrients. Finally, the secret ingredient for success? Balance. Merging carbs, proteins, and healthy fats leads to optimal performance. So, remember, what you eat matters more than you think. Choose wisely, and crush those goals.
